Blasts heard in rebel-held city in eastern Ukraine - Reuters witness

DONETSK, Ukraine – The sound of a number of blasts have been heard at round 1615 GMT on Monday within the centre of the town of Donetsk, which is held by Russian-backed separatists in japanese Ukraine, a Reuters witness mentioned.

The character of the blasts was unclear.

President Vladimir Putin instructed his Safety Council on Monday that Russia ought to think about recognising the independence of two breakaway areas in japanese Ukraine, a step that will intensify its standoff with the West and Kyiv.
